When considering a Warehouse Management and Inventory Control System, it’s essential to understand the features that can enhance your operations. Here are some standout features:- Real-Time Inventory Tracking: This feature allows you to monitor stock levels in real-time, ensuring that you always know what’s in your warehouse. This can help prevent stockouts and overstock situations, which can be costly.
- Automated Reordering: With automated reordering, you can set minimum stock levels for your products. When inventory dips below this threshold, the system can automatically place orders with suppliers, saving you time and reducing the risk of human error.
- Barcode Scanning: Integrating barcode scanning into your inventory management process can significantly speed up the receiving and shipping of goods. It enhances accuracy and reduces the time spent on manual data entry.
- Reporting and Analytics: Comprehensive reporting tools provide insights into your inventory turnover rates, sales trends, and stock levels. This data can help you make informed decisions about purchasing and sales strategies.
- Multi-Location Support: If your business operates in multiple locations, having a system that supports multi-location inventory management is crucial. It allows you to track inventory across various warehouses seamlessly.
While these features can greatly enhance your operations, it’s important to consider how they align with your specific business needs.
Who It's For
A Warehouse Management and Inventory Control System is beneficial for a variety of businesses, including:- Retailers: If you run a retail operation, managing inventory effectively is key to customer satisfaction. This system helps ensure that you have the right products available when customers want them.
- E-commerce Businesses: For online sellers, accurate inventory management is essential to avoid overselling and to maintain customer trust. This system can help you manage stock levels across multiple sales channels.
- Manufacturers: Manufacturers can benefit from improved inventory control, ensuring that raw materials are available when needed and that finished goods are tracked efficiently.
- Wholesalers: If you operate as a wholesaler, managing large volumes of inventory can be challenging. This system can help streamline your operations and improve order fulfillment.
Pros and Considerations
Like any system, a Warehouse Management and Inventory Control System comes with its advantages and some considerations:Pros
- Increased Efficiency: Automating inventory tasks can save you time and reduce errors, leading to smoother operations.
- Improved Accuracy: Real-time tracking and barcode scanning help minimize discrepancies in inventory counts.
- Better Decision-Making: Access to detailed reports and analytics allows for informed business decisions.
Considerations
- Learning Curve: Depending on the complexity of the system, there may be a learning curve for your team. Training may be necessary to maximize the system’s potential.
- Integration with Existing Systems: Ensure that the Warehouse Management and Inventory Control System can integrate with your current software solutions to avoid disruptions.
